Transaction 31c2912429345bdb3d5685b1b4e395465475addccf6e7466d98ed142703866a3
1 Input
1 Output
-
31c2912429345bdb3d5685b1b4e395465475addccf6e7466d98ed142703866a3: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fbcbe47683151feb78181ff72a4175d4f99ecade71968e868b0d53ea7949d65f
- address
- bc1pl097ga5rz507k7qcrlmj5st46nueajk7wxtgap5tp4f7572f6e0stkyc0a